Sun River Health is seeking a highly skilled Patient Navigator/Patient Representative to join our team at our White Plains, NY location. As a Patient Navigator/Patient Representative, you will play a vital role in providing patient-centered care and facilitating access to services in a pleasant, knowledgeable, and efficient manner.
Key Responsibilities:- Assist with daily reception activities and ensure that all processes needed for patient services are initiated.
- Communicate effectively with team members and patients regarding all aspects of service.
- Responsible for telephone and mail contact with patients.
- Facilitate patient care within different departments of Sun River Health and outside agencies.
- Refer patients to appropriate agencies, with a focus on referrals to specialty care and public health insurance programs, as needed and appropriate.
- Consult with medical staff to link patients to services through the provision of ancillaries such as translation, transportation assistance, and application assistance.
- Responsible for all necessary clinical information available to specialists for referral groups; track referral appointments and obtain consultant reports; obtain consent for release of information.
- Assist patients in overcoming obstacles that prevent them from receiving needed referrals.
- Provide basic instruction/health education to clarify provider instructions, procedures, and referral needs.
- Responsible for the scheduling of appointments, fee collection, explanation of services and charges for patient services.
- Verify all insurance and set fees based on the sliding scale fee.
- High School diploma/GED
- 2-4 years of work-related experience
- Preferred language: Bilingual in both English and Spanish (orally and written)
Sun River Health is a network of over 40 Federally Qualified Health Centers (FQHCs) providing primary, dental, pediatric, OB-GYN, and behavioral health care to over 245,000 patients annually. With a dedicated staff of 2,000 doctors, nurses, and healthcare professionals, we pride ourselves on delivering high-quality, affordable care to those who need it most.
Sun River Health started in 1975 when four African American mothers spearheaded efforts to open our first health center in Peekskill, New York to deliver accessible, high-quality, affordable services to patients in need, regardless of race, religion, income, or insurance status. Today, after 45 years of service, Sun River Health is still delivering on that promise to communities across the Hudson Valley, New York City, and Long Island.
